Counter-Strike : Global Offensive Achievements Explained

Hi, first off Achievements or Awards are given to players for completing a certain tasks in the game. Counter-Strike : Global Offensive has divided it into 5 Classes. (well I call it classes) The five classes are Team Tactics, Combat Skills, Weapon Specialist, Global Expertise and Arsenal Mode. Each classes has its own achievements/awards and by completing a number of achievements/awards on each classes you earn a Medal.
Each Medal has its own ranking by color which is Copper/Silver/Gold meaning the more awards/achievements you get in a certain class ranks up your Medal. Copper being the lowest Gold being the highest. Medals are displayed in-game when you press (tab) showscore button. Other people can also see the medals you have but it doesn't really determine the skill you have in-game. Some people who don't have medals or only a few maybe even be better skill-wise. Arsenal Arms Race Game Mode on Counter-Strike : Global Offensive Beta



The latest addition to Counter Strike : Global Offensive Beta game mode is the Arsenal Arms Race
Every time you kill an enemy a new weapon is rewarded instantly. You win the game when you or a teammate gets to the last weapon which is the knife and kill an enemy team with the knife. Basically a race to knife game probably why its called "Arsenal Arms Race"
